Transaction bfbb9ceae29bd5343496b9753e52676e5517c863443bcb0ba37fe09675949420

1 Input
2 Outputs
  • bfbb9ceae29bd5343496b9753e52676e5517c863443bcb0ba37fe09675949420:0
  • value  148516346
    address  18s2MrywQq4m4ZAQPCDMsuUmamCLtLk8Gv
  • bfbb9ceae29bd5343496b9753e52676e5517c863443bcb0ba37fe09675949420:1
  • value  11581193
    address  1DxazTndmnnZHXE4KGxSPe3op6TNbn6AGj